Eighty per cent of people who worked from home over Covid do not want to return to their old ways. Many companies laid people off, others treated some people very badly. People have realised their old life styles were not fulfilling and want a change. Where does that change start?
Why are we where we are?
What do you think of the short-term thinking of companies which change direction at the first sign of problems ahead?
Is the main objective of companies to make profits, or are there others?
This book is about Wave-Makers , people who are changing the world by creating better places to work.
‘Making Waves’ demonstrates the relevance of Deming to business management in the 21st century. It is a splendid introduction to sustainable process improvement’ Anthony Robinson, retired Managing Director
Have you been frustrated with the way Short-Term thinking is leading us ?
Do you want to be part of a movement taking businesses towards better practivces, based on ethics and standards?
This book looks at business leaders who believe in and practice the kind of business which attracts people with a desire to contribute to our society.
Be prepared to be challenged with a thinking which can really change the world!
